Blood Test Options Available in OxfordA Detailed Overview of Common Blood Test Options Available in Oxford

When individuals search for ‘blood tests near me’ in Oxford, they typically refer to a variety of routine tests aimed at evaluating overall health. Below are some of the most frequently requested tests:

  1. Complete Blood Count (CBC): This comprehensive test evaluates red and white blood cell counts, hemoglobin levels, and platelet counts, providing a broad overview of your health status and identifying potential issues.
  2. Biochemistry Profile: This test examines kidney and liver function, checks electrolyte balance, and may also assess glucose and cholesterol levels for a complete health evaluation.
  3. Lipid Profile: This assessment measures cholesterol and triglyceride levels, which are crucial for assessing cardiovascular health and identifying risk factors.
  4. Thyroid Function Tests: These tests measure levels of TSH, T3, and T4 to evaluate potential hypo- or hyperthyroidism, shedding light on thyroid health.
  5. Blood Glucose and HbA1c: These tests are essential for screening and monitoring diabetes, providing critical data for effective management of the condition.
  6. Vitamin and Mineral Checks: Commonly assessed nutrients include Vitamin D, B vitamins, and iron levels, which are vital for overall health and wellness.

Advanced Blood Testing Services Tailored to Meet Unique Health Needs

Not everyone seeks routine assessments; some individuals require in-depth evaluations to explore ongoing symptoms or manage complex health conditions. In these cases, people often look for blood analysis or functional laboratory testing, which delves deeper into the biochemical functioning of the body. Examples of specialized tests include:

  1. Hormone Panels: Beyond standard thyroid tests, some clinics offer fertility hormone panels, stress hormone (cortisol) assessments, and comprehensive male/female hormone profiles to address specific health concerns.
  2. Allergy and Food Intolerance Tests: These tests are designed to identify potential allergies or intolerances to specific foods, dust, pollen, and other allergens, facilitating better dietary choices and health management.
  3. Comprehensive Nutritional Profiles: These tests measure amino acids, fatty acids, and various micronutrients, often sought by individuals looking to optimize their dietary intake for improved health.
  4. Autoimmune Panels: Tests that search for markers of autoimmune con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, or celiac disease, providing essential information for diagnosis and management.
  5. Chronic Disease Monitoring: For those with conditions like HIV, hepatitis, or various cancers, specialized blood tests can assist in tracking disease progression and evaluating treatment effectiveness.

Blood Test AppointmentEssential Preparation Tips for Your Upcoming Blood Test Appointment

Preparing for a blood test appointment is generally straightforward; however, there are several vital considerations to ensure a smooth experience:

  1. Fasting Requirements: Certain tests, particularly those assessing blood glucose or cholesterol levels, may necessitate fasting for 8-12 hours prior to the test to ensure accurate and reliable results.
  2. Medications and Supplements: It’s essential to inform your clinician about any medications or supplements you are currently taking, as these can significantly influence test results and their interpretations, potentially impacting your healthcare decisions.
  3. Hydration: Staying well-hydrated can facilitate the blood draw process, making it easier for healthcare professionals to locate your veins and ensuring a smoother experience during the procedure.
  4. Timing: Some hormone tests, including cortisol or reproductive hormones, must be drawn at specific times of the day or month to ensure the accuracy of results, making proper planning essential.

Following any pre-test instructions closely is crucial for ensuring the accuracy of your results. Most private clinics will provide a fact sheet or discuss these requirements during the appointment booking process to help you prepare effectively and minimize any complications.

Your Experience During the Blood Test Appointment: What to Anticipate

Most private blood tests or appointments in Oxford involve a straightforward and efficient process:

  1. Check-In: The blood testing lab will confirm your details and set a date for a nurse to visit your home or for you to come in for your test.
  2. Pre-Test Consultation: A healthcare professional will verify which tests you’re undergoing and explain the procedure in detail, ensuring you understand and feel comfortable throughout the process.
  3. Blood Draw: The clinician will cleanse the area, usually in the crook of your arm, apply a tourniquet, and draw blood using a sterile needle, ensuring a safe and hygienic process that minimizes discomfort.
  4. Sample Labeling: Your blood sample will be labeled and sent to the lab for thorough analysis, adhering to strict protocols to maintain accuracy and integrity in testing.
  5. Aftercare: A small plaster will be placed over the puncture site, allowing you to typically resume your normal activities shortly afterward without any issues.

If you experience anxiety or discomfort during the procedure, it’s important to communicate this to the clinician. They can offer reassurance, utilize alternative veins if needed, or provide relaxation techniques to help ease your experience. The entire process usually lasts less than 30 minutes, making it a quick and efficient way to prioritize your health.
